Grape hyacinths may be petite, but what they lack in size, they make up for in beauty and ease of care. Largely, you can plant grape hyacinths in the fall and forget about them for months until they emerge from the ground and enliven an otherwise empty early-springlandscape. Choose a site with average soil that drains well; grape hyacinth bulbs will rot if planted in a site that remains wet. Muscari latifolium is native to pine forests in Turkey, this species of grape hyacinth is a perennial bulb that is perhaps the largest of the muscaris, typically growing to 12” tall.
